Flat roof vent installation services involve adding specialized vents to the surface of flat roofing systems to improve airflow and manage moisture levels. These services typically include assessing the roof’s structure, selecting appropriate vent types, and securely installing them to ensure they function effectively. Proper installation helps maintain the integrity of the roofing material while providing necessary ventilation, which can extend the lifespan of the roof and prevent issues caused by poor airflow.

One of the primary problems addressed by flat roof vent installation is excess moisture buildup. Without adequate ventilation, moisture can accumulate within the roofing layers, leading to problems such as mold growth, roof degradation, and reduced insulation efficiency. Additionally, vents help release heat trapped in the attic or roof space, preventing heat buildup that can cause premature aging of roofing materials. Correct vent placement and installation are crucial to ensure these issues are effectively mitigated.

Properties that commonly utilize flat roof vent installation services include commercial buildings, industrial facilities, and residential structures with flat or low-slope roofs. Commercial properties often require extensive ventilation solutions to support HVAC systems and maintain indoor air quality. Industrial facilities benefit from specialized vents designed to handle large volumes of air or fumes, while residential buildings with flat roofs may need vents to prevent moisture problems and improve overall roof performance.

Material Costs - The cost of materials for flat roof vent installation typically ranges from $150 to $400 per vent, depending on the type and quality of vent selected. Higher-end materials may increase overall expenses. Local pros can provide detailed estimates based on specific project needs.

Labor Expenses - Labor costs for installing flat roof vents generally fall between $200 and $600 per vent, influenced by roof complexity and accessibility. Some projects may incur additional charges for preparation or finishing work.

Additional Fees - Extra costs may include permits, which can range from $50 to $200, and potential repairs to the roof deck or insulation. These fees vary based on local regulations and the condition of the existing roof.

Cost Factors - Overall expenses depend on the number of vents installed, roof size, and vent type. It’s advisable to contact local service providers for precise estimates tailored to specific flat roof configurations.

What are the benefits of installing vents on a flat roof? Installing vents helps improve airflow, reduce moisture buildup, and prevent heat accumulation, which can extend the lifespan of the roof.

How do professionals determine the number of vents needed? Local pros assess the size of the roof, attic space, and ventilation requirements to recommend the appropriate number and type of vents.

What types of vents are commonly used for flat roofs? Common options include exhaust vents, intake vents, and specialized roof vents designed to suit flat roofing systems.

Is flat roof vent installation a complex process? The installation process can vary in complexity depending on the roof's structure, but experienced contractors are equipped to handle the work efficiently.

How long does flat roof vent installation typically take? The duration depends on the roof size and type of vents, but most installations can be completed within a day or two by local service providers.
